Suicide is NOT a Solution





How to Overcome Suicidal Thoughts?

In 2016 the number of suicides in India had increased to 230,314. This was the most common cause of death in the age groups of 15–29 years and 15–39 years. In 2019 More than 30% of suicides are reported to be due to Family issues. While Love affairs, relationship issues, Drug addiction, and Illness has also contributed distinctly as a cause for suicide. Maharashtra and Tamil Nadu share the maximum percentage of suicides that took place in 2019. Even though the suicide rate decreased slightly from 2015 till 2017 but then the numbers increased consistently in further years.

According to WHO India and China account for 40 percent or more of the 800,000 annual suicide deaths globally.

Many would have a common question: Why someone would commit suicide? These people are stuck in a hopeless situation and their thinking gets narrowed with negative thoughts. Only Medical treatments such as Psycho-therapy may improve their state.


Sometimes people may feel completely ‘Empty’ as they have no one to care for or no one to care them, in other words, they would not have a reason to live. For people with this kind of feeling, the best way to overcome depression and suicidal thoughts is to Create a reason to Live.

It can be anything….. Unfold yourself and start traveling to new places, start to meet new people, share your feelings, and also try to understand theirs. Go ahead and do things that pleases you and most importantly try to support the people with similar kind of feeling.


If anyone needs to overcome depression or stress, please feel free to contact through the following helpline numbers:

Jeevan Aastha Helpline: 1800 233 3330

India Suicide Helpline: 9152987821
